The Steve Wilkos Show Season 9 Episode 80 What Did You Do to My 3-Year-Old Child?
In season 9, episode 80 of The Steve Wilkos Show, titled "What Did You Do to My 3-Year-Old Child?," a mother confronts her ex-boyfriend about his alleged abuse of their child. The mother claims that her ex-boyfriend, who is the father of the child, has physically abused the child by hitting her with a belt and leaving bruises on her body. The mother is visibly upset and emotional as she describes the abuse she believes occurred.
The ex-boyfriend denies the accusations and claims that he has never laid a hand on their child. He states that the mother is just trying to make him look bad and gain full custody of the child. He also claims that the bruises on the child's body were from accidents, such as falling down or bumping into something.
Steve Wilkos listens to both sides and brings out a child abuse expert to give her opinion on the situation. The expert examines the photos of the child's injuries and testifies that they are consistent with physical abuse. She also notes that the mother's story is consistent and credible, while the ex-boyfriend's story has inconsistencies.
In an emotional moment, Steve Wilkos confronts the ex-boyfriend and tells him that the evidence against him is overwhelming. He pleads with him to come clean and admit what he did so that he can get help and the child can be protected. The ex-boyfriend eventually breaks down and admits to hitting the child with a belt.
The mother is relieved and grateful for the truth coming out, and Steve Wilkos reassures her that she did the right thing by coming forward. The ex-boyfriend is arrested on the show for child abuse, and the mother is awarded full custody of the child.
The episode ends with Steve Wilkos urging viewers to speak out against child abuse and to report any suspected cases. He also reminds parents to be vigilant and to protect their children from harm.
